The best-selling book is now an iPhone App at last.

***** THE CHORD WHEEL; The Ultimate Tool for All Musicians *****

The Chord Wheel is a revolutionary device that puts the most essential and practical applications of chord theory into your hands.

This tool will help you:
UNDERSTAND CHORDS - Know the 'when, why and how' different chords work together.
IMPROVISE & SOLO - Talk about chops! Comprehend key structure like never before.
TRANSPOSE KEYS - Instantly transpose any progression to any key.
COMPOSE MUSIC - Watch your songwriting blossom! No music reading is necessary.

This product is intended for beginners and intermediate students; if you can rattle off the chords of a ii-V7-I progression in the Key of Bb and know whether a C7 sound good in this key without thinking about it, you may not need it. For the rest of us, here is the answer.

Though it's still primarily intended for musicians, the iPhone App version allows users to depress the wheel's cells and hear the chords played back in the instrument and chord voicing selected in the 'Settings' page. The result is an entertaining song composer that allows you to play chord progressions without any musical knowledge whatsoever. For musicians, it allows your ears to hear the relationships between chords and key.

Not bad....This app is designed for intermediate and above level players. If you do not know how to find C, C7, Cmaj7, Cm, and Cm7 chords already, then I wouldn't bother with this app just yet. This app is designed to help you find those "breath of fresh air" chords which will help you resolve your progressions. This app will not tell you which notes are in a chord! So if anything, this app would be a hinderance to you. Learn all your notes on a piano and or guitar. Then learn the five previously mentioned chords/triads. Once you get a basic understanding of where all the chords are and how to find them, learn some basic progressions such as I-IV-V and III-VI-II-V-I. If you are not familiar with anything I just mentioned, then this app really won't help you much since you will still have to know where to find the chords on piano or guitar. With that being said, this app has really helped me resolve a few progressions I've been working on. I have found this app very useful..Version: 1.0

Wonderful app for vocalists and SolfègeI am vocalist who is trying to learn solfeggio. I purchased Jim Fleser's book, "The Chord Wheel", (published by Hal Leonard), and this app. LOVE them both. I sing in a choir, and have difficulty finding the lower harmony part, as I sing alto. My habit is to sing the melody, or soprano part. My whole reason for learning Solfège is to try to find and hit a lower, harmonizing note. The great thing about this app, for me, is that when I play the sequence of ascending notes in a scale, (each one a chord), I can hit the root note of the key. It is the fact that the scales ascend in chords that makes it easy for me to find my starting note. That is why I use this app, rather than a piano app, when I am singing with a choir. The book and app are great for trying to add solfeggio prompts to musical scores. For example, if I am in the key of D, I set the dial to the key of D. Then, I can see at a glance, that I - Do - D ii - Re - E iii - Mi - F sharp IV - Fa - G V - So - A vi - La - B vii - Ti - C sharp I also learned a lot about major scale diatonic 7ths.
